The question has surfaced again and again: What is wrong with Window 8?

for me it's not so much what is wrong with win 8 (complete lack of visual cues, inconsistency, etc) as what is wrong with the big picture.

for apple it's a no-brainer. their market penetration on desktop is minimal. they 'own' the tablet market for now. Even if Android devices are now going to invade the tablet market as they have with the smartphone market it doesn't mean a slowdown for apple. the market expands so quickly apple can still grow. if they can make macbooks and imacs a natural choice for ipad owners needing a desktop ot laptop computer that would mean a lot to them. so it will make sense to make macos more ios-like.

what i don't get is microsofts logic here. they have no market penetration whatsoever on tablet or phone. they 'own' the desktop. Why risk the desktop market in a first attempt to get into tablets? "the ui formerly known as metro" can get good for tablets once they fix the usability issues. expect win 9 to be much, much better. but i cannot see how win 8 can become good for a desktop. it's just all wrong. they are forcing this unfinished tablet-centered and very inflexible ui on desktop users who had enough trouble with the upgrade from 98 to xp. and they are surprised they didn't sell a lot of win 8 pc's for xmas?

why not go the more 'natural' route? Live with fragmentation for at least the first release, with the new ui only on tablet and phone releases. fix the problems. experiment with how it would be received on desktop (release it as a free extension for the desktop OS).

imho gnome did a few mistakes with gnome 3 and the way it was released. but gnome-shell is doing it right where win 8 is doing it wrong. by offering a set of visual cues, basic behaviour and workflow that is consistent, but with a completely minimal desktop that can then be expanded into what you need on a desktop or a tablet.

F18, realmd and Active Directory

F18, realmd and Active Directory

In Fedora 18 there is no need to mess around with winbindd to log into your work account anymore. SSSD in combination with the new realmd and the new gnome user manager can autodiscover kerberos domains and set up automagically. Active Directory is supported. Just make sure you have realmd installed and you should get 'Enterprise login' as a choice when setting up a new user. A dropbox should list all autodiscovered domains.

I tried this the day after the beta was launched, and I had to set selinux to permissive mode to get it working.

Nice feature for enterprise users!

Make your own wallpaper - a quick Gimp walkthrough


Make your own wallpaper - a quick Gimp walkthrough

First of all: Install Gimp. If you run Linux it should be in your repositories. For Fedora just do a 'yum install gimp'. For windows, get it from http://gimp.org

Start Gimp, and in the 'Windows' menu select 'Single-window mode'. This is usually easier to understand for beginners than the default mode.

'File' -> 'New...' and set the image size to match your monitor resolution. For me it's 1920x1200.

Now remember that if you make any mistake, hit Ctrl-Z to backstep until you  are back to where things went wrong. Then try again.

You now have a 'layer' called 'Background', and the color used to draw is set to black by default. Press the 'Bucket fill' icon at the left edge of your drawing and then click in the background. Great. Now you have a completely black wallpaper.

Next press the 'Text tool' icon (the letter), and then click on the black square at the bottom of the left hand icons and switch to a new foreground color. Click anywhere in your wallpaper and type something. Your text will be created in a new layer on top of the background. As you can see, it's way to small, so select your entire text, and then adjust font size and/or other attributes.

Switch to the 'Move tool' and let's place your text correctly. It's not enough to just click within the text you want to move, you have to actually hit one of the letters or you will move the background instead. Remember that ctrl-Z is the easiest way to redo a mistake.

We could be done here, but let's spice it up. Right click the text layer in the layer list at the upper right. Select "Layer to image size". Without this step some of the filters will resize your image to just the border around the text. Then try 'Filters' -> 'Alpha to logo' -> 'Alien glow'.

Now you have 2 new layers. You can turn layers on and off by clicking on the eyes to the left in the layer list. When you have the result you want, save using 'File' -> 'Save as' first. This saves a version in the gimp xcf format. This is the format you want if you want to re-edit, as it saves all those nice layers. Then 'File' -> 'Export...' and save in a format you can use as a wallpaper. .jpg or .png should do nicely. Exit Gimp, and select your new wallpaper the way you normally do on your OS. Enjoy your digital creation. Then go back to gimp and play around. Perhaps get the Gimp Paint Studio extension that brings more brushes and stuff for the artist in you.

Some dogs need space

Some dogs need space
 
If you see a dog with a yellow ribbon on the leash this is a dog who needs some space. Please do not approach this dog or its people with your dog. They are indicating that their dog cannot be near other dogs. How close is too close? Only the dog or his people know, so maintain distance or give them time to move out of your way.
There are many reasons why a dog may need space:

Maybe he has health issues or is in training.
She may be a rescue dog being rehabilitated. The world can be a very scary place for these dogs.
He may have had a bad experience with another dog or just not like the kind of friendly dogs who always want to say “Hi!”
In short, a yellow marker on a dog means it needs a little space.

A very important decision from the UK High Court.

A very important decision from the UK High Court. Apple's design arguments dismissed by referring to 50 examples of prior art.

Originally shared by Nicolas Charbonnier

UK High Court dismisses Apple’s design arguments vs Samsung by referring to 50 examples of prior art
Apple's design patent claims have been dismissed by the UK High Court by simply referring to 50 designs that were previously created or patented, from before 2004. These include the Knight Ridder (1994), the Ozolin (2004), and HP’s TC1000 (2003). The court found numerous Apple design features to lack originality, and numerous identical design features to have been visible in a wide range of earlier tablet designs from before 2004.

With 50 examples of prior art dating back nearly 20 years, Apple has no such further claims to make!

The same easy case of simply showing prior art can simply be used by all other Android makers when defending themselves against bogus Apple patent lawsuits!

Microsofts demands for certified hardware for win 8 are scary.

Microsofts demands for certified hardware for win 8 are scary.


http://www.softwarefreedom.org/blog/2012/jan/12/microsoft-confirms-UEFI-fears-locks-down-ARM/
On Intel they demand that the UEFI boot loader must support custom mode (where the owner of the device can add signatures for other operating systems) and that it must be possible to disable secure mode completely. This is reassuring for users of alternative operating systems, since any Win 8 certified system should then be unlockable at the UEFI level.

On ARM it is quite opposite. On ARM microsoft cannot be accused of being a monopolist, so on that platform they demand that UEFI must only be able to run in secure mode, and with no possibility for custom mode. Meaning no way to add new certificates. This means that certified win8 units running with ARM processors will be completely locked down to only run certified operating systems where the signature is preloaded from the manufacturer.

I see no demand here that vendors cannot preload certificates for other operating systems, so if this is really the future for ARM hardware then The Linux Foundation may want to coordinate a list of certificates for all linux distros and make these available for hardware vendors? That would give them a possibility to still be compliant with the microsoft demands, and at the same time allow us to boot linux. Hopefully the certificate list can still be legally updated by firmware patches from the manufacturer so support for new operating systems can be added that way?
